Universal Favored Class Bonuses

MistveilRules → Universal Favored Class Bonuses
When a player character gains a level in a Favored Class, they may gain one of the following general bonuses:

Alternatively a player character may gain any of the special Favored Class Bonuses that usually specific to different player races even if the player character is not the race that is normally connected to the type of bonus, with GM approval.

Note: When using this alternate rule for Favored Class Bonuses the Faster Learner feat changes to the following: Fast Learner (UFCB)

Reasoning: The main purpose of this rule is to make FCBs always be useful regardless of player race and class. That is done in two ways, first by making more generally useful bonuses that apply to more types of characters and second by opening up the racial bonuses. I decided to do this because there are so many repeat bonuses that are shared across multiple races and clearly have nothing to do with the race itself and because I never want something to feel pressured to play a certain race/class combination over what they actually want to play due to wanting to use a FCB that they wouldn't get otherwise. I added the bit about GM approval for the rare few FCBs that actually have a strong connection to their race and might not make any sense on other, very different, races.